MC: OVER ONE MILLION COMMODITY PRICE MONITORING TASKS CONDUCTED ACROSS KSA IN 9 MONTHS

03 Oct 2022

 

The Ministry of Commerce continues to monitor outlets and the prices of commodities and products Kingdom-wide. 

The inspectors carried out over 691 thousand market and price monitoring tasks and over 35 thousand price monitoring field visits from the beginning of January to the end of September 2022. Over 1 million price readings of commodities and products were taken at all outlets. 

The Ministry monitors the prices of 278 essential commodities in all regions and sends the readings to an electronic system to be rigorously monitored and to identify any inappropriate actions impacting commodity prices for urgent action.  

These inspections are intended to monitor markets, price levels, and product abundance, ensuring the availability of different suppliers and substitute products. The visits make sure that businesses comply with the Ministry's laws in order to protect the rights of consumers.
